Hotfix Decision Matrix
A lightweight framework for deciding whether to hotfix now, hold for the next patch, monitor, or escalate.
| Issue | Player Impact | Frequency | Fix Risk | Urgency | Confidence | Recommendation |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| Crash spike after candidate build | High | Medium | Medium | High | Medium | Escalate for hotfix review after QA confirms repro rate. |
| Reward progression delay | High | Low–Medium | Low | Medium | Medium | Monitor logs, prepare CS messaging, include fix in next safe release window. |
| Missing localized strings | Low | Medium | Low | Low | High | Bundle with next patch unless already included in candidate build. |
| Store entitlement inconsistency | High | Low | Medium | Medium | Low | Investigate further before hotfix; prepare workaround communication. |
| Social feature intermittency | Medium | Medium | Unknown | Medium | Low | Continue monitoring and escalate if peak-hour failure rate increases. |
Recommendation is based on player impact, frequency, fix risk, deployment complexity, and confidence level.

Go / No-Go Decision Summary
Hold final submission until crash regression verification is complete.
- 1QA confirms crash repro rate and affected build range.
- 2Engineering confirms fix risk and rollback path.
- 3CS/Community approve known-issue language.
- 4Release Ops confirms final package timing.
The goal is not simply to ship fast — it is to ship with clear risk ownership, player-impact awareness, and a shared decision record.
Retro & Process Improvement
What Happened
Candidate build surfaced a platform-specific crash regression late in the readiness window while parallel player-facing issues were still being monitored.
What Went Well
Owners were identified quickly, CS/Community were looped in early, and the go/no-go path was made visible before final submission pressure.
What Needs Improvement
Earlier platform-specific smoke testing and clearer escalation thresholds would reduce late-stage ambiguity.
Next Process Change
Add a pre-go/no-go risk review 24 hours earlier, with severity thresholds, rollback owner confirmation, and approved known-issue language drafted in advance.
